Context: The SPCX Market Microstructure SpaceX's secondary stock, traded on platforms like Forge Global and SharesPost, has been a volatile beast since its June listing. The stock surged above $200 before retreating to $105, driven by locked-up share unlock fears and shifting risk appetite. Duang's entry point came during the trough. On July 24, he sold 1,000 SPCX put options with a strike price of $115, expiring December 18, 2026, at a premium of $23.26 per option—a total premium inflow of $2.326 million. Twelve days later, on August 5, he bought 100,000 shares of SPCX at $108.68 per share, costing approximately $10.868 million. With the stock now at $140, the equity position shows an unrealized gain of $3.132 million, plus the already collected premium, yielding a total paper profit of $5.458 million.
But this is not a simple bullish bet. It is a synthetic covered call strategy with a tail risk. The put writing gave him a premium cushion, and the direct stock purchase gave him upside exposure. Core: The On-Chain Evidence Chain I reconstructed the trade's cash flows and breakeven points using a Python-based option pricing model, integrating SPCX's historical volatility (60-day HV of 85%) and the December 2026 implied volatility (which hovered around 110% at trade inception). The put sale at $23.26 for a strike of $115 implies a breakeven of $91.74 for the put writer—meaning if SPCX falls below $91.74 by expiration, Duang starts losing money on the put leg. Simultaneously, the stock purchase at $108.68 has a lower breakeven of $108.68. But the combined strategy has a net cost basis: $108.68 (stock) minus $23.26 (premium) = $85.42 per share, ignoring opportunity cost. So his effective breakeven on the fully hedged position is $85.42. If SPCX stays above $115, both legs profit. If it drops between $85.42 and $115, the stock loss is partially offset by the premium. Below $85.42, both legs lose money, and the put assignment forces him to buy more shares at $115, worsening the loss.
The key risk is the put assignment. Duang sold 1,000 puts, each representing 100 shares, so he is short 100,000 shares worth of put exposure. If SPCX falls below $115 at expiration, he must buy 100,000 shares at $115 (or deliver cash equivalent). That would add $11.5 million of additional capital deployment, bringing his total exposure to 200,000 shares. The current paper profit of $5.458 million is based on the stock price of $140. But if the stock tanks to $70, the put assignment would force him to buy at $115, locking in a $45 per share loss on the assigned shares, plus the original stock position losing $38.68 per share. The put premium of $23.26 only partially offsets that. His maximum loss scenario is not trivial.
